Transaction 2ec3081c2e6831b5a4f515d886fac7006c17534b958586538c268b25d157d354
1 Input
1 Output
-
2ec3081c2e6831b5a4f515d886fac7006c17534b958586538c268b25d157d354:0
- value
- 584040
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8ec64b955e04ca853952a8addf7610b2f767e5bc OP_EQUALVERIFY OP_CHECKSIG
- address
- LYEsmFMXizBTG4vnfXHwpnerVHSPDBS4AL